Position Overview

The Cardiac Reporting Operations Manager will lead a team of Reporting Supervisors and senior staff across reporting operations, ensuring excellence in service delivery, reporting quality, and cross-functional coordination. This role is responsible for optimizing processes through automation, enhancing interdepartmental workflows, managing projects, and driving continuous performance improvements.

This is a leadership role that requires strong people management skills, operational acumen, and experience driving digital transformation in a healthcare environment.

Responsibilities:

Team Leadership & Performance Management

  • Manage and mentor a team of Reporting Supervisors, who oversee reporting technicians, nurses, QA, and education functions.
  • Set clear goals and performance standards; conduct regular evaluations, feedback sessions, and career development planning.
  • Ensure team structure and coverage align with business needs, including scheduling, workload distribution, and budget management.
  • Participate in weekend/holiday manager rotation.
  • Go in to office and assist with staffing as needed

Cross-Departmental Communication & Strategic Collaboration

  • Act as the primary point of coordination between Reporting, Engineering, Onboarding, Revenue Cycle Management, Account Management, and Support teams.
  • Lead communication around system updates, critical issues, and reporting workflow changes across the organization.
  • Ensure seamless integration of new clinics by working closely with Sales, Onboarding, and Support to define and meet reporting expectations.

Reporting Operations Oversight

  • Oversee all reporting processes, including technician training, accuracy audits, device advisory management, and reporting schedules.
  • Maintain and improve KPI benchmarks including >98% alert accuracy and >90% summary consistency.
  • Lead the implementation and documentation of updated reporting guidelines, protocols, and best practices.

Process Optimization & Automation

  • Evaluate and redesign workflows to maximize efficiency using automation and data tools in partnership with Engineering.
  • Spearhead projects to implement new technologies or software that improve reporting turnaround, accuracy, and scalability.
  • Manage configuration and maintenance of the transmission processing engine and scraper alert systems.

Project & Data Management

  • Own and coordinate cross-functional projects related to reporting services, onboarding data, and patient portal clean-up.
  • Maintain project timelines, track progress, manage risks, and communicate updates to internal and external stakeholders.
  • Develop reporting dashboards, quality metrics, and performance indicators using appropriate analytics tools.

Education and Experience

  • 5 years of experience leading operational or clinical teams, with at least 2 years managing supervisors or senior staff.
  • Prior experience working in cardiac device clinics or remote patient monitoring preferred.
  • Strong working knowledge of digital health platforms, reporting tools, and healthcare data workflows.
  • CRAT or CCT certification required
  • Bachelor’s degree required; clinical credentials (RN, NP, PA) are a plus but not required.
  • IBHRE preferred
  • You are a natural leader who thrives in managing and developing high-performing, distributed teams.
  • You embrace technology to simplify operations and are excited to identify automation opportunities that drive impact.
  • You understand clinical environments, especially cardiac care, and have experience navigating healthcare technology platforms.
